About Us.
In the year 2010 some friends of 2003 matriculation batch of “Masjidbati Parbati High School” (H.S.) thought to create an initiative to think and take some initiatives to work on mitigating the social problems in Sundarban. First, they started informally with some micro finance and computer training. Then one Society was registered in the year 2010 named “Prachesta Welfare Society” at Masjidbati in Basanti. After there were some challenges. They (The team of the friends) gradually went outside for their education and Job purpose. So, few years later the initiative was gradually little slow and inactive. Again, the initiative was taken over their younger fellow Mr. Suchandan Mistry, who continued the computer education training Centre. At that centre He organised many short- term vocational training batches like – Computer Training, Tailoring Training, Beautician training and also Cultural training (like – Music, Recitation, Drawing). The computer centre was run a Franchise by “BIIT” (Bharat Institute of Information Technology). Even from the year 2018 an annual Cultural Programme (Recital, Drawing, Song, Dance, Debate, Quiz and Exhibition) used to organise on the observation day Swami Vivekananda’s birth day wish was started in the Banner of “Prachesta Welfare Society”. Thus a lot of local student and people were encouraged for active participation. The programme was continued till the year of covid attack. In that initiatives a local magazine was also start. The magazine name was “Prabah”, it means “Flow”. The content of the magazine were Rhyme, Poem, Prose, Sort stories, which have been collected from local students and people. Everything was going well. But unfortunate during “Amphan” disaster all the papers / documents of “Prachesta” were lost. After few years Mr. Suchandan Mistry again started with full of encouragement and energy. He has registered and started a foundation (Non-profit organization) under section 8 company act (MCA, Ministry of Corporate Affairs, Govt. of India) and its name “FAMEDU INDIA FOUNDATION” in short “FIF” in the year 2023. FAME + EDU = FAMEDU. “Fame” is a English word, means reputation, “Sukhyati / Sunam” (in Bengali). It is a foundation, from where students get digital literacy and some basic computer knowledge. And this education will support them at least to enter in the job sector. Now the Centre is located in “Gosaba” block, also has registered at this address. The “FIF” is now successfully continuing the computer training, Job grooming / Career counselling for the students of Gosaba & Basanti block..

Foundation
It is about 100 km distance from Kolkata to Sundarban. Mainly the Sundarban area is in the Southern and South-eastern part of West Bengal. The Sundarban area is a full of Mangroves (near 16 million mangroves are there). A major percentage of Oxygen is produced from this area. The people from different area of the world comes to Sundarban to visit as there are many types of Mangroves, Animals like Royal Bengal Tiger, Deer, Wild Pigs, Giant Crocodile and the natural beauty. The Sundarban area is consisted with many multiple sizes deltas. Many attracted facts are there in Sundarban to attract the tourist but in other hand there are many lacks which are directly and indirectly affecting the daily living of the local citizen. Specifically, the natural disaster, lack of drinking water and also water for cultivation, lack of infrastructural development, no proper, technical, Digita, Vocational and Cultural education centre available. Even there is no Counselling and Motivational centre. Very lengthy and poor communication among the deltas. These all-result unemployment, poverty, Migration, Bad health, lack of social safety, and all these are continuing as cycle wise. That is why an initiative was taken by the local students. It was decided to start and increase the digital literacy as that is one of the problem in the rural Sundarban for have taken the initiative to work on education mainly on technical, digital, skill development and lack of social safety among the above issues

Computer training Programme
The computer Training is the flagship programme of “FIF” (Famedu India Foundation). As at the very beginning it was targeted to work on the employability for the Unemployed in the Sundarban Area, the “FIF” emphasises on the Career counselling, digital literacy and employable soft skill development for the youth and the Computer training is the on-going programme. Among rural people there are some lacks like awareness on career, job opportunity and along with that the soft skill lack is there. Even there are very few training centres are available who continuously provide the computer education, because of low rate of admitted students, thus the cost of running the centre is sometimes goes to cross the earning thus maximum centre do not sustain properly. The “FIF” has a very good networking with the surrounding schools and each of the years “FIF” mobilise a number of students of class X and XII after their exam to learn about Digital skill. There are many courses available like – I. ADPOM II. ADPDEO III. ADPWD IV. CPCSP V. ADPAT VI. ADPE VII. CPBCK Etc. After the completion of the courses the students get acknowledgment certificate, and they can show that to the employer later when they are decided to enter in the job sector.
Livelihood – Vocational / Skill training -
Apart from the Computer training, “FIF” organise some skill based short term livelihood training such as – Beautician, Tailoring etc. There are many women successfully started their individual enterprises after getting training from “FIF”.
